Fundraiser for WHS teacher Kate Toohey
Fri Mar 28, 2008, 02:30 PM EDT
Wakefield -


Wakefield - Wakefield High School students, faculty, staff and friends will host a fundraising dinner dance Thursday, April 3 for WHS math teacher Kate Toohey. She was diagnosed in 2007 with ALS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is ALS neurodegenerative disease commonly referred to as Lou Gehrig’s Disease. Toohey, who uses a microphone to amplify her voice, is still teaching her daily classes.

The Kate Toohey ALS benefit will be held in the WHS cafeteria beginning with a buffet dinner, 5:30-7:30 p.m., followed by music, dancing, games, raffles and a silent auction from 7:30-9:30 p.m.

Proceeds from the benefit will help defray some of the costs associated with Toohey’s future care, including purchasing an electric wheelchair, wheelchair accessible transportation, computer software to help her communicate, and making renovations to her home.
